World AIDS Day Panel Discussion

We will be hosting a panel discussion on HIV/AIDS-related challenges in medicine, research, and policy spheres, featuring distinguished Duke faculty members as panelists, including:

Carolyn McAllaster, JD, Colin W. Brown Clinical Professor of Law, Founder of the Duke HIV/AIDS Policy Clinic and the Duke AIDS Legal Project, and Director of the Southern HIV/AIDS Strategy Initiative (SASI).

Mehri McKellar, MD, Associate Professor of Medicine and Infectious Disease Specialist, Director of Duke PrEP Clinic for HIV Prevention, and Faculty Advisor for "Know Your Status."

Sherryl Broverman, PhD, Associate Professor of the Practice in Biology and Global Health, Co-Founder and Chair of the Women's Institute for Secondary Education and Research (WISER).

Kent Weinhold, PhD, Joseph W. and Dorothy W. Beard Professor of Surgery, Professor of Immunology, and Director of the Duke CFAR.
